What is 5G?

5G is the fifth generation of mobile networks. It was first rolled out in 2018 and since then it has become a standard for phones and other connected devices using 5G. It is the super fast successor to the previous generation 4G because, in theory, you can achieve a download speed of 4.2 gigabits per second. Significantly more than a 4G network, at 20 megabits per second. In practice, a download speed of 1 gigabit is expected, which is still much faster. That speed also ensures that there is less delay (latency) when connecting to the mobile internet.

We are becoming increasingly dependent on wireless technology. Many services are digital and more and more devices are connected to the Internet and communicate with each other, which is also referred to as the Internet of Things (IoT). People want to have a fast connection for both business and private life, preferably everywhere. That is exactly what a 5G network can make possible.

What new technology makes up 5G?

Network Architecture:

5G technology is based on a new network architecture that is designed to offer faster speeds and improved latency. This architecture is based on multiple network components such as cloud radio access networks (CRANs), edge computing, and distributed antenna systems (DAS). By leveraging these components, 5G technology can provide faster speeds and improved latency.

Frequency Bands:

5G technology operates using a variety of frequency bands, including millimetre wave (mmwave), sub-6GHz, and mid-band frequencies. Each of these frequency bands offers different benefits, allowing businesses to choose the best option for their needs.

Modulation:

5G technology uses a variety of modulation techniques, such as OFDM, OFDMA, and SC-FDMA. These modulation techniques are designed to provide improved speeds and increased bandwidth, allowing for more efficient data transfer.

Current use cases and industries that are using 5G

5G is currently being used in a variety of industries, including healthcare, manufacturing, government, automotive, retail, and entertainment. In healthcare, 5G is being used to support remote patient monitoring, telemedicine, and medical imaging.

Manufacturing:

5G is being used for predictive maintenance and robotics control.

Government:

5G is being used for smart city applications, such as traffic management, public safety, and energy management.

Automotive:

5G is being used for connected and autonomous vehicles, as well as enhanced infotainment systems. In retail, 5G is being used for in-store analytics and customer engagement.

Entertainment:

5G is being used for enhanced gaming experiences, virtual reality, augmented reality, and streaming services.

The future of 5G

The 5G rollout not only meets the increasing demand for mobile data communication with as little delay as possible. It also enables new applications. Think, for example, of self-driving cars, drones that deliver orders, remote operations, and the automation & robotization of industrial processes, such as fully automated container terminals.

5G is not so much a revolution as it is an evolution. The transition is going step by step, it will take time before the whole of the United States has 5G coverage.

In any case, telecom service providers are already making their cellular networks '5G ready'. Many new smartphones already have a 5G modem and a number of providers offer 5G subscriptions.
